Kosovo President Hashim Thaci has been warning a meeting with US President Donald Trump for a week. On Monday he traveled to New York to attend the annual meeting of the United Nations Assembly, where he was supposed to meet with the first of the United States in the traditional expectation of [...]
Last night, media reported that Thaci and Trump would meet at around 2: 00 a.m., according to local time in Kosovo. It has been almost 13 hours, and there is still no announcement from the presidency that the meeting has been held.
Thaci from New York last night warned that he would meet Trump and talk about the final agreement between Kosovo and Serbia, which includes border correction.
While the meeting is not known to have happened, and if what has been discussed among them, Serbian Prime Minister Anna Brnabiq has announced that he has had the opportunity to meet Trump in the UN Assembly meeting margins.
Brnabyq, has announced that Trump has thanked, as she put it, “for a new approach to Serbia”.
Meanwhile, Thaci has published reports from meetings with various world leaders, but not with the American president. /Periscopi/
